Post by: Bob Johnson on November 02, 2009, 06:23:39 PM
How come there's no locking nut?

Thats a good question.

It may get a string lock but at the moment the really straight pull, the locking tuners and the super slippy Earvana nut seem to make it an unnecessary complication. The Captain wants to use the strings above the nut to get some Matt Bellamy type squeals that necessitate having no string guides or other impediments to the sound being transmitted down the neck.

Post by: Bob Johnson on November 04, 2009, 09:37:00 PM
Bob, you should ignore the Cptn and fit a locking nut! He can always leave the locking nut off if he wants it to go out of tune and make silly noises. Looks daft without it too  8)

It isn't going to go out of tune Lew; I don't make guitars that go out of tune :) :)

The Earvana nut, which really can help with intonation. dictates that a locking nut is out. If there's any sign of instability in the tuning it'll get a string lock immediately behind the nut. "looking daft" doesn't really enter into it.
